Music groups spread Christ's message in concert

Soft heavenly voices float around the walls, and instruments roar through the doors of the music suite. Every year the high school ensemble, concert choir, jazz band and concert band perform for family and friends at the FC Christmas Concert on Dec. 16 at 7 p.m.

“This concert has been a tradition for many years,” choir and ensemble director, Marc Ferguson, said. “It has been in existence for well over 20 years.”

From the beginning of the school year, choir and band prepare for the concert. Months of hard work, memorization and commitment pay off in the end.

“The band has been working very hard and continues to do so,” Paul McEntee, jazz and band director, said. “The practices are getting more intense in preparation for the performance, but I know that they will do great at the concert.”

A new flavor was added to some of the choir songs by including instruments in addition to the piano. One of the songs, “They Had Joy” that choir sings has McEntee playing a guitar.

“I love how choir is adding other instruments to “They Had Joy,” Leah Brouwer, ’03, said. “It sounds great and would be wonderful if other songs had instruments accompany the piano, too.”

In Ferguson’s opinion, the purpose of the Christmas Concert is to get people in the Christmas Spirit!

“We want to share our music with friends and family,” Ferguson said. “Our intention is to spread the good news of Jesus’ birth to the people we love dearly.”

Like athletes, music students look forward to perform for people, to show what they have been working so hard for.

“I’ve been participating in this concert for about three years now,” Sam Westra, ’03, said. “I enjoy being apart of choir and band, plus I get to show off my talents to people.”

For parents, grandparents, and others plan to attend, there will be an offering taken to benefit the staff and teachers at Christmas.

This year’s FC Christmas Concert will be held at Community Bible Church on Maple & Nees.
